Size: a a a

A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2

2021 July 14

ЯН

Ярослав Н in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Господа нужен совет\подсказка. Собрал систему из области cv,  детектирует и классифицирует объекты. рабочую версию на 1 видеопоток тестили просто на цпу. А тут заказчик выкатил новую идую чтоб дали ему рекомендацию какой ГПУ ему купить чтоб прога работала на 10 видеопотоков при заданном фпс. Как оценить?
У меня тз данных есть только скорость обучения используемых сеток на разных ГПУ.
Как блин вообще оценивать хардварные требования? перебором арендовать и тестить????))
источник

П

Павел in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Можно попробовать запустить в колабе. И посмотреть...
источник

D

Dmitry in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Хороший совет. Мы так один раз с заказчиком граничные параметры железа утрясали
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
или аренда, или оценить грубо вычислительную мощность в у.е. по бенчмаркам, сравнить с эталонной некоторой "вашей" и вывести коэффициент при имеющейся нагрузке и затрачиваемой памяти, условно считая, что каждый независимый поток потребляет столько же условно столько же мощности и памяти.
Еще вариант перейти на простейшие операции и их количество, и скорость их выполнения.
либо смотреть на похожие функциональные примеры
источник

ЕК

Евгений Кривошлыков... in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Что такое простейшие операции?
источник

ЯН

Ярослав Н in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
блин у меня 4 нейронки разных, устану тут считать по операциям.
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
умножение/деление/т.п.
источник

ЕК

Евгений Кривошлыков... in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
А что так можно было?
источник

D

Dmitry in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
у нас не прошло, вьедливый :( был ...
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Самый незапаривательный колаб или альтернатива, либо похожая архитектура и ее производиьельность в подобной задаче. На грубую прикидку
источник

ЕК

Евгений Кривошлыков... in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Нейронные сети это же умножение
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
кнчн
источник

D

Dmitry in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
а чем идея с колаб не подходит?
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Ну, его можно понять😁
источник

ЯН

Ярослав Н in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
начал деплоить)) но вдруг еще идеи есть
источник

SL

Sergey L in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
нетолько лишь + зависит от вашей задачи все же
источник

ЕК

Евгений Кривошлыков... in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
Сам принцип нейронок это перемножение сигнала на коэффициенты связи.
источник

D

Dmitry in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
кстати, прогони с TPU, у нас в конечном итоге была собрка с TPU.
на свою голову показали, тогда.

Но опыт возни с ними был бесценный ...
источник

ЕК

Евгений Кривошлыков... in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
С точки зрения расчётов нейронки не отличаются от любого другого метода решающих деревьев или расчёт соседей.
источник

D

Dmitry in AI / Big Data / Machine Learning 👮‍♂️ Protected by R2D2
да, можно так оценивать. Но это если у заказчика есть адекватный техперсонал, который понимает о чем вы говорите ;)

а когда там живот мешает рубашке сходиться ... ой
источник